About Savannah O'Berry

Savannah O'Berry is a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) practicing in Alabama who supports people through complex emotional challenges. She works with clients facing anxiety, depression, trauma, and life transitions, offering a compassionate, client-centered approach that emphasizes self-compassion, improved communication, and personal growth.

She places value on understanding each person's distinct history and current needs, and she is particularly committed to working with young adults, women, and those experiencing workplace stress, relationship difficulties, or questions about personal identity. Her practice focuses on helping clients build resilience, process past experiences, and strengthen meaningful connections.

Savannah uses evidence-based methods to tailor care to each individual, honoring personal stories while helping clients develop tools for coping and change. She aims to create a supportive therapeutic environment that empowers transformation and steady progress toward greater well-being.

Could Remote Therapy Be a Good Fit?

Many people ask whether online therapy can meet their needs. For common concerns such as stress, anxiety, depression, relationship challenges, and major life changes, online therapy has been found to be comparable in effectiveness to traditional in-person sessions for many clients.

One clear benefit is flexibility. Clients can connect with a therapist in the format that works best for them - video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or in-app messaging - which helps make counseling easier to integrate into busy schedules.

Licensed professionals are available to offer evidence-based approaches and therapeutic support, and clients may switch therapists if they seek a different fit. Online therapy can be a practical option for those looking for accessible, consistent support from qualified therapists.
